I don't understand Nissans logic..
The 2010 370z comes with the 19inch wheel standard. However, the website and brochures (which arn't cheap to print) all show the 18inch wheels along side the convertible with it's 19's. Sorry guys, Its been done before. 2008 EVO X MR owners tryed it and MY08 WRX owners tryed it. When you sign on the dotted line for your vehicle with that Vin. Thats it.... The only way you would get "good will" would be via your dealership NOT Nissan direct. Just dont worry guys. Wait 6months.. Heaps of 19inch wheels will pop up on ebay. Nissan has always updated their cars every 12-24 months so getting 19" is not at all surprising. If someone was seriously dupped by the car dealers telling them 19" will never come to Aust than they should check their heads - just look at the US market, nobody bought the car with the 18's and of course Nissan decided just to drop the ugly 18's completely. The brochure people refer to still shows MY2009, so please don't refer to it, there are no MY2010 brochures out yet, just some silly bulletins. |
